 On Mon, Oct 06, 2003 at 07:05:24AM +0000, Jens Rehsack wrote:
 > Dirk Meyer wrote:
 > 
 > ...
 > 
 > > Same here.
 > > Why set "WANT_OPENLDAP_VER", as "USE_OPENLDAP=yes" do the full job.
 > > 
 > > Please move this option before "bsd.port.pre.mk"
 > 
 > I think same way. But the autodetection code of Alex is surely a good
 > idea and helps out in some times avoiding broken dependencies because
 > of unlucky defaults.
 > 
 > Maybe it's a good idea to Alex to submit the autodetection routine
 > as a patch of Mk/bsd.ports.mk and reduce (as often recommented)
 > it's ports mysql and openldap support to USE_MYSQL/USE_OPENLDAP.
 
 Errr... I think another version of this autodetection has been part
 of bsd.port.mk ever since the introduction of the USE_MYSQL option:
 take a look at the MYSQL_VER variable setting around line 1534 of
 bsd.port.mk...
